COURSE DESCRIPTION
This course aims to cover various relevant aspects of fish health, welfare, and disease management, such as good welfare practices and operational welfare indicators. Updated information on key diseases affecting trout farming in Europe will be provided. Additionally, the course will emphasise the importance of optimal biosecurity practices and their role in animal production and disease prevention.
TARGET AUDIENCE
The training course is designed for trout farm managers, trout farm staff, technical personnel, biologists, and service & supply staff.
OUTLINE COURSE
Tutors: Hamish Rodger, Meritxell Diez-Padrisa (PatoGen AS)
Topics covered:
• General principles of fish health and welfare
• Fish anatomy
• Optimal procedures for fish necropsy and sampling
• Trout diseases
• Biosecurity
• Welfare considerations during fish farming operations
• Welfare indicators
